Transaction 42ebc8ff083cb46fec67c662c30bf5ff1240245a22f795a60b3d1e9b93512950

63 Input
2 Outputs
  • 42ebc8ff083cb46fec67c662c30bf5ff1240245a22f795a60b3d1e9b93512950:0
  • value  74983523
    address  2N5qPyA1JpEWyNqCrf3KKP2TjFTDTX2Lq3w
  • 42ebc8ff083cb46fec67c662c30bf5ff1240245a22f795a60b3d1e9b93512950:1
  • value  500000000
    address  2N9a5DqD95iGKfHxk69EMKYce2qMSBPfPZH